Talal Alotaibi, public relations manager at Almarai, said: "As a company that is dedicated to fulfilling consumers' daily needs of nutritious food and beverage products, we are honoured to be in the UAE today to activate this initiative and reaffirm our commitment to making a positive impact on people's lives in the markets that we serve.
"Our partnership with the RCA is founded on mutual trust and the common aim of enabling communities to fulfil their potential. We look forward to building on this initiative under the guidance and with the assistance of the Red Crescent Authority in the UAE.”
In the first phase, which started on Sunday, Almarai has distributed over 30,000 long-life milk bottles to a number of families in the UAE, "and we might look forward to other initiatives to support students with daily school groceries of Almarai products”, he added.
Mohammed Abdullah Alhaj Al Zaroni, Manager of the UAE Red Crescent's Dubai branch, said: "As part of our humanitarian efforts in the UAE, it is important for us to have a strong support from true partners of the private sector such as Almarai. Through this strategic partnership, we will reinforce our roles and abilities to increase the reach of our relief efforts across the nation's emirates, providing basic nutritional requirements to a very large number of families registered with us.
"We look forward to further cooperation with Almarai in various areas of community engagement in order to provide essential relief services to as many people as possible.” – Khaleej Times
